Woman killed in rollover wreck that closed I-70 near Oak Grove
One person was killed when a car and truck collided on Interstate 70 between Oak Grove and Grain Valley Wednesday, according to a crash report.
A 2022 Dodge Ram pickup truck and a 2010 Toyota Scion were driving east on I-70 near mile marker 25.4 around 4:30 p.m. when the Toyota struck the truck, according to a Missouri State Highway Patrol crash log.
The Toyota then drove off the left side of the road into the median and overturned, ejecting the driver. The car came to rest in the westbound lanes of I-70, the highway patrol said.
Paramedics pronounced the driver of the Toyota, a 55-year-old female, dead at the scene. Two passengers, both female juveniles, were transported to a hospital with minor injuries, the highway patrol said.
A 58-year-old driver of the pickup truck was not injured in the crash, according to the crash log.
All lanes of I-70 were closed at Oak Grove for a little over two hours while crews worked to clear the wreck. At around 7:30 p.m., all lanes of traffic reopened.
An investigation is ongoing while troopers work to determine what led to the crash.
